RouteValueEqualityComparer Класс
Определение
Важно!
Некоторые сведения относятся к предварительной версии продукта, в которую до выпуска могут быть внесены существенные изменения. Майкрософт не предоставляет никаких гарантий, явных или подразумеваемых, относительно приведенных здесь сведений.
Реализация IEqualityComparer<T> , которая сравнивает объекты как если бы они были строками значения маршрута.
public ref class RouteValueEqualityComparer : System::Collections::Generic::IEqualityComparer<System::Object ^>
public class RouteValueEqualityComparer : System.Collections.Generic.IEqualityComparer<object>
type RouteValueEqualityComparer = class
interface IEqualityComparer<obj>
Public Class RouteValueEqualityComparer
Implements IEqualityComparer(Of Object)
- Наследование
-
RouteValueEqualityComparer
- Реализации
Комментарии
Значения, которые не являются строками, преобразуются в строки с помощью Convert.ToString(x, CultureInfo.InvariantCulture)
.
null
значения преобразуются в пустую строку.
Строки сравниваются с помощью OrdinalIgnoreCase.
Конструкторы
RouteValueEqualityComparer() |
Реализация IEqualityComparer<T> , которая сравнивает объекты как если бы они были строками значения маршрута. |
Поля
Default |
Экземпляр по RouteValueEqualityComparerумолчанию . |
Методы
Equals(Object, Object) |
Реализация IEqualityComparer<T> , которая сравнивает объекты как если бы они были строками значения маршрута. |
GetHashCode(Object) |
Реализация IEqualityComparer<T> , которая сравнивает объекты как если бы они были строками значения маршрута. |